TADA’s Youth Ballet Company is for serious, highly-motivated dancers who wish to train as pre-professionals in anticipation of a future in classical and contemporary ballet. CLICK HERE FOR AUDITIONS. YBC dancers fulfill greater weekly ballet training requirements, and commit to regular rehearsals and performances depending on level. YBC dancers benefit not only from personal evaluations, close monitoring, and mentorship by the YBC Director and specific YBC Ballet Faculty, but they also enjoy many featured roles in all of TADA's ballet productions including our annual Nutcracker, Winter Showcase, Spring Ballet, and more according to level. YBC dancers also compete in prestigious ballet competitions including YAGP and the UBC. Additionally, YBC dancers age 13+ can audition for our Pre-Professional Collegiate Program.

TADA offers RAD ballet classes for students who wish to train and take exams under this leading international method. The RAD was established in 1920 in Great Britain, creating an international syllabus, standards, and guidelines for student and teacher certification. Students can take exams at the end of the term, and based upon score can gain a certificate for level completion and advancement. TADA offers RAD ballet classes levels pre ballet and higher exclusively under our certified RAD ballet instructors.
